Zelensky’s diplomatic tour: from Saudi Arabia to Japan
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skiy has arrived in Hiroshima, Japan to attend the G7 Leaders Summit.
According to the NHK State Television news report, Zelenskiy landed at Hiroshima airport at 3:30 p.m. local time with a plane belonging to France. Zelenskiy tweeted: “Japan. G7. Important meetings with partners and friends from Ukraine. Security and greater cooperation for our victory. Peace will come closer today, ”he said.
Volodymyr Zelenskiy will meet the leaders and will aim to reinforce the existing solidarity of the G7 countries with Ukraine in the face of Russian attacks. Zelenskiy is expected to hold bilateral talks with US President Joe Biden and Japanese Prime Minister Kishida Fumio on the sidelines of the summit.
In the statement of the Japanese Ministry of Foreign Affairs, it was noted that on the last day of the summit it was decided to hold a session on Ukraine among the G-7 leaders with the participation of Zelensky himself.
With said visit, Zelenskiy made his first trip to the Asian region after February 2022, when the Russian attacks began. The summit, hosted by Japan, which will be attended by the leaders of the US, France, England, Germany, Canada, Italy and the European Union (EU), will end on May 21.
The leaders of Indonesia, India, South Korea, Australia, Brazil, Vietnam and representatives of international organizations were also invited to the summit. (AA)
